各位老铁们好,相信很多人对margin属性是什么都不是特别的了解,因此呢,今天就来为大家分享下关于margin属性是什么以及css中margin的4个属性的问题知识,还望可以帮助大家,解决大家的一些困惑,下面一起来看看吧!
html的margin属性
这里是让这个table的左面有4.65pt的边距。
margin属性分别对应的是:上右下左,你这里上、右、下都是自动,只有左边设置了4.65pt
还是建议你不要用table排版,用div+css更容易控制页面一些
margin属性是干什么用的
margin:0auto0px表示上外边距为0px,左右外边距自动,下外边距为0px。margin:02px表示上外边距和下外边距是0px,右外边距和左外边距是2pxmargin:0auto表示上下外边距为0px,左右外边距为自动。说明:块级元素的垂直相邻外边距会合并,而行内元素实际上不占上下外边距。行内元素的的左右外边距不会合并。同样地,浮动元素的外边距也不会合并。允许指定负的外边距值。
margin只打两个元素是什么方向
1,margin只打两个元素,第一个是上下方向,第二个是左右方向;
2,margin简写属性在一个声明中设置所有当前或者指定元素外边距属性。该属性可以有1到4个值。margin写法有4种,分别如下:
margin:参数1;margin:参数1参数2;margin:参数1参数2参数3;margin:参数1参数2参数3参数4;
以上四个位置按顺序分别为:margin-top--margin-right--margin-bottom--margin-left,即“上-右-下-左”。其中需要注意的是后三种情况,当有像素值缺省时,浏览器会自动对缺省像素按照“bottom=top”和“left=right”的方法进行赋值。
html5 margin属性有继承性吗
html5margin属性是用于在一个声明中设置四个外边距的所有属性的简写属性。没有继承性,也就是它的设置的margin值不会自动传递到下一级标签中。
margin后面的参数个数可以是一个,两个,三个或四个。
◆一个参数,例如:margin:10px;表示四边外边距10像素;
◆两个参数,例如:margin:10px5px;表示上下外边距10像素,左右外边距5像素;
◆三个参数,例如:margin:10px5px2px;表示上外边距10像素,左右边距5像素,下边距2像素;
◆四个参数,例如:margin:10px5px2px1px;表示上外边距10像素,右外边距5像素,下外边距2像素,左外边距1像素。
margin和padding属性的区别
一、指代不同
1、padding:凑篇幅的文字。
2、margin:页边空白。
二、语法不同
1、padding:artifactconsistingofsoftorresilientmaterialusedtofillorgiveshapeorprotectoraddcomfort由柔软或有弹性的材料组成的人工制品,用于填充、塑造、保护或增加舒适度。
2、margin:margin指书页的空白边缘,也可指物体的边缘
END,本文到此结束,如果可以帮助到大家,还望关注本站哦!